Test Plan Note — Calendar Sync Conflict (Tindervale Scheduler)

Scenario: two clients edit the same event offline, then sync. Expected behavior: the Larkmoor merge service keeps the later timestamp and files a conflict record. Verify the losing edit appears in the conflicts pane and no duplicate events are created. Run against the staging tenant only. Authenticate your test client to the sync endpoint using the bearer token below.

bearer token for hagug-kawip: eyJhbGciOiJIUzI1NiIsInR5cCI6IkpXVCJ9.eyJzdWIiOiIydxNAjDeTmIn0.L86yxoGFcrhy

Subject: GrowCell controller — sensor drift fix shipped

Team, the humidity drift on GrowCell units running firmware 3.2 traced back to a calibration offset that accumulated after each soft reboot. The patch re-baselines on startup and adds a drift alarm at 4%. Field units in the Tellbrook pilot look stable after 48 hours. The patched build is below.

build token for bajog-yaduf: htk9_39788324c

**Q: Why does my change trigger a full rebuild instead of an incremental one in Staticore?**

Incremental rebuilds rely on the dependency graph emitted during the last successful build. Edits to shared layouts, global config, or the taxonomy map invalidate the whole graph by design. If a leaf-page change still causes a full rebuild, that's a bug — please report it to the build-tools maintainers at the address below.

escalation mailbox, bafog-fafog: ulador@paliqlabs.internal

### v3.2.0 — Renamed setting

Keyspindle no longer reads `KS_ROTATE_TOKEN`; it was renamed for consistency with the plugin API. Plugins targeting 3.2+ must use the new name or rotation hooks will not fire. The old name is ignored silently — no deprecation warning is emitted. Update your `.env` before upgrading. Keep `KS_PLUGIN_DIR` and `KS_LOG_LEVEL` as-is. Immediately after those entries, add the renamed token line with your existing value.

secret setting of kawif-kajef: COURIER_KEY3=d2b